I only ever use struct for POD or anonymous structures. It makes more sense to have the public members first, it doesn't matter to the implementer but to someone reading the code as a user generally they won't be looking at the private section.
This was one thing I did enjoy about D. While not actually having a very well-endowed standard, they removed the need for redundant keywords. Struct and class mean two different things in D and are treated differently (outside of just semantics and permissions).
Yah it is too bad C++ didn't make that distinction I almost never implement virtual functions (and other features) in a struct and it's obviously impossible to do so in C.

I would actually like to know, however, why some people put multiple consecutive access specifiers, like why people will put "public:", then some functions, then another "public:", and some more functions. Does this actually do anything? Is it some convention? I'd like to know because it seems odd.
I used to do it because I wanted to split up code and data. I'd put private data at the top, private methods next, then public data and then public methods last.
